Facilitation of Quercus ilex in Mediterranean shrubland is explained by both direct and indirect interactions mediated by herbs

1. Competitive and facilitative interactions shape plant communities. Whereas a number of studies have addressed competition and direct facilitation among plants in dry ecosystems, indirect facilitation has received little attention.ud2. We investigated the relative importance of direct and indirect facilitation by the nurse plant Retama sphaerocarpa on late-successional Quercus ilex seedlings mediated by herb suppression in a Mediterranean shrubland in 2006 and 2007. We also studied whether facilitation outcome depended on the size of the facilitated seedlings. 3. A field experiment was carried out to test the effect of (i) position of Q. ilex seedling with respectudto shrub canopy (under shrubs or in gaps), (ii) herb competition (presence or absence), and (iii) seedlingudsize. 2006 was an average rainfall year while 2007 had a much more humid spring and a dryerudsummer than 2006.ud4. In both years, nurse shrubs reduced seedling mortality whereas herbs increased it. In the averageudrainfall year, seedling mortality under shrubs was unaffected by herbs whereas in gaps it was signifi-udcantly higher in presence of herbs. This showed that the nurse shrub indirectly facilitated the seedlingsudby reducing the competitive capacity of herbs. Conversely, facilitation was predominatelyuddirect during the humid spring and dry summer year since herbs hindered seedling survival similarlyudunder the nurse shrub and in gaps. The nurse shrub directly facilitated the seedlings by reducingudseedling photoinhibition and water stress.ud5. Improvement of environmental conditions by Retama benefited smaller seedlings but not largerudseedlings since the nurse shrub reduced mortality of smaller seedlings relative to that in gaps, butudthis effect was not observed for larger seedlings. This indicates that individuals within a seedlingudpopulation may not have the same response to facilitation.ud6. Synthesis. Both indirect and direct facilitation are important mechanisms for Q. ilex regenerationudin Retama shrubland and their importance seems to vary with climatic conditions. Indirect facilitationudby release of herb competition under nurse shrubs is important in years of dry springs whenudcompetition between nurse shrubs and herbs is high, whereas direct facilitation mediated by microclimateudamelioration increases with summer aridity
